LAI Wins Manufacturing Contracts for Land-Based Gas Turbine Components
SCOTTSDALE, Ariz., Oct. 10 /PRNewswire/ -- LAI International, Inc.,
strategic supplier of precision components and sub-assemblies for original
equipment manufacturers has announced it has secured contract awards for
manufacturing land-based gas turbine machinery.
LAI uses proprietary milling technology to process more than 1,000 of the
static gas turbine components used in power generating plants for a leading
original equipment manufacturer.
"LAI has proven its success in manufacturing these non-rotating sub-
assemblies for several years, and now we have been asked by our customer to
take on more of the value chain," Darcy Dodge, Director of Strategic Products
for LAI, said. "We will continue to leverage our advanced manufacturing
technology to meet our customer's quality, delivery and cost requirements."
The contracts are expected to be valued at more than $6 million over the
next two years.
